Quad LVPECL clock source: 100 MHz and 125 MHz on four outputs
The DSC400-2222Q0118KE2T is a quad-output MEMS-based XO from Microchip's DSC400 family, delivering LVPECL clock signals at 100 MHz and 125 MHz on all four outputs — two frequency pairs, each pair identical.
Wide supply tolerance simplifies rail assignment
Operating from 2.25 V to 3.6 V, the oscillator runs off either a 2.5 V or 3.3 V rail without a dedicated LDO.
